Latest Patents
Sven Johannsen's patent, titled "Electrical Connection Test for Unpopulated Printed Circuit Boards," outlines a novel method for evaluating the electrical connections in unpopulated printed circuit boards. The innovative approach involves exposing the circuit board to temperatures typical of a reflow soldering process in the initial step, followed by a thorough testing phase to ensure proper electrical connections. This method is beneficial for improving quality assurance in circuit board manufacturing and also encompasses a test device as well as a process for producing populated printed circuit boards.
